Setup GitHub Repository Governance
Apply the fleet-standard GitHub repository configuration to this project's repo. The settings, rulesets, and deploy key that used to be clicked together by hand for every new repo are applied here as one scripted flow.
What gets applied

Workflow
Step 1 — Locate the scripts
In the Lisa repo itself, use scripts/ directly. In a downstream project, use the installed package:
LISA_SCRIPTS=$(ls -d node_modules/@codyswann/lisa/scripts 2>/dev/null || echo scripts)
Step 2 — Dry-run and show the plan
bash "$LISA_SCRIPTS/lisa-github-repo-setup.sh" --dry-run .
Present what would change. If the repo already matches the baseline, say so and stop.
Step 3 — Apply
bash "$LISA_SCRIPTS/lisa-github-repo-setup.sh" .
Requires gh authenticated with admin permission on the repo. A 403 on rulesets means the plan doesn't support them (private repo on a free personal plan) — settings and deploy key still apply; the script skips rulesets gracefully.
Step 4 — Wire the approval gate into an existing deploy.yml (guided edit)
Only when .lisa.config.json has a github.environments entry with require_approval: true AND .github/workflows/deploy.yml exists but does not reference approval_environment:
[ -f .github/workflows/deploy.yml ] \
&& jq -e '[.github.environments // {} | .[] | select(.require_approval == true)] | length > 0' .lisa.config.json > /dev/null 2>&1 \
&& ! grep -q 'approval_environment' .github/workflows/deploy.yml \
&& echo "deploy.yml needs approval wiring"
A grep hit is only a first pass — before skipping the edit, read the release job's with: block and confirm it actually passes both require_approval and approval_environment from the determine_environment outputs (a commented-out or unrelated occurrence doesn't count as wired).
deploy.yml is create-only — the project owns it, so Lisa never patches it automatically. Show the user the two changes from the current stack template (<stack>/create-only/.github/workflows/deploy.yml in the Lisa repo) and offer to apply them via Edit:
- In
determine_environment, add a checkout step plus the 🚦 Resolve approval gate from .lisa.config.json step, and expose the approval_environment / require_approval outputs.
- In the
release job's with: block, replace require_approval: false with:
require_approval: ${{ needs.determine_environment.outputs.require_approval == 'true' }}
approval_environment: ${{ needs.determine_environment.outputs.approval_environment }}
Skip this step (and say why) if the project's deploy.yml doesn't call Lisa's release.yml (rails uses release-rails.yml and harper-fabric has no release call — approval gating for those stacks is not wired yet).
Step 5 — Verify
gh api "repos/$(gh repo view --json nameWithOwner -q .nameWithOwner)" \
--jq '{allow_squash_merge, allow_auto_merge, delete_branch_on_merge, allow_update_branch}'
gh api "repos/$(gh repo view --json nameWithOwner -q .nameWithOwner)/rulesets" --jq '[.[].name]'
When environments were configured, also confirm each one carries its protection rules and branch policy:
gh api "repos/$(gh repo view --json nameWithOwner -q .nameWithOwner)/environments" \
--jq '.environments[] | {name, protection_rules, deployment_branch_policy}'
For every environment declared in github.environments, treat a missing deployment_branch_policy — or, when require_approval is true, an empty protection_rules — as a failure: the environment exists but is unprotected, so an approval gate bound to it would block nothing.
Report the applied settings, ruleset names, and environments. If any step failed, surface the error — do not mark the setup complete.
